FC Porto continued their impressive form with a commanding 3-0 victory over Alverca at the FC Alverca Sports Complex in the Primeira Liga. Borja Sainz was the star of the evening, netting twice to lead Porto to a comfortable win. The match saw Porto dominate possession and create numerous chances, reflecting their current unbeaten streak.

Sainz Sets the Tone Early

The first half saw FC Porto take control early on, with Borja Sainz opening the scoring in the 29th minute, assisted by R. Mora. Porto's fluid passing and movement kept Alverca on the back foot, and they went into the break with a 1-0 lead.

Porto's Second-Half Surge

In the second half, Porto continued their dominance. A. Varela doubled the lead in the 57th minute, and just 12 minutes later, Sainz struck again, sealing the victory with his second goal. Despite Alverca's efforts, they struggled to break down Porto's defense, which remained resolute throughout.

Statistical Insights

Porto's control was evident in the statistics, with 60% possession and 14 total shots compared to Alverca's 8. Borja Sainz's performance was highlighted by his two goals and a player rating of 9. Meanwhile, Alverca's best efforts came from Marko Milovanović, who managed three shots on target.
